Binghamton University (SUNY) vs University of Wisconsin-Madison: Acceptance Rate, SAT & Net Price

Binghamton University (SUNY) and University of Wisconsin-Madison are about equally selective, admitting 37.3% and 40.8% of applicants respectively. For a family earning $48,001–$75,000, the average net price is about $20,347 per year at Binghamton University (SUNY) versus $13,234 at University of Wisconsin-Madison. Admitted students post SAT middle-50% ranges of 1360–1480 at Binghamton University (SUNY) and 1370–1490 at University of Wisconsin-Madison.

Binghamton University (SUNY) vs University of Wisconsin-Madison: admissions and cost statistics from the most recent Common Data Set, IPEDS, and College Scorecard
MetricBinghamton University (SUNY)University of Wisconsin-Madison
Overall acceptance rate37.3%40.8%
Early acceptance rate50.0%45.0%
SAT middle 50%1360–14801370–1490
Avg unweighted GPA3.73.9
Yield rate17.0%29.0%
Class size3,2488,514
Net price, $48,001–$75,000 income$20,347$13,234
Net price, over $110,000 income$28,475$27,890

Admissions and cost data as of July 3, 2026 (CDS 2024–25 cycle), from the most recent Common Data Set, IPEDS, and College Scorecard. Rows appear only where both colleges report the statistic.

Frequently asked questions

Is Binghamton University (SUNY) harder to get into than University of Wisconsin-Madison?

The two are about equally selective: Binghamton University (SUNY) admits 37.3% of applicants and University of Wisconsin-Madison admits 40.8%, based on the most recent Common Data Set.

Which is cheaper for a middle-income family, Binghamton University (SUNY) or University of Wisconsin-Madison?

For a family earning $48,001–$75,000, the average net price is about $20,347 per year at Binghamton University (SUNY) and $13,234 at University of Wisconsin-Madison, so University of Wisconsin-Madison is the lower-cost option at that income level (source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ard/IPEDS data).
